位於東灣布利桑頓市(Pleasanton)的三谷大學(Tri-Valley University)的華裔創辦人兼校長蘇曉萍(Susan Xiao Ping Su,音譯)涉嫌掩護非法移民集團,為非法移民核發學生簽證,已遭聯邦檢察官提出控告。
聯邦地方檢察官於周三提出的訴訟書指稱,三谷大學向國土安全部謊報資料,為數百名非法移民(多數來自印度)非法核發學生簽證,讓他們留在美國。而持學生簽證留在美國者,必須出示在學證明,證明的確有到校選課和上課。
檢方並指稱,蘇曉萍涉嫌這宗精心策劃的詐騙,「使三谷大學蒙羞」。訴訟書指出,三谷大學透過非法核發學生簽證,讓非法移民取得學生簽證留在美國,並因此賺進數百萬元。
聯邦移民暨海關執法局官員周三前往位於圓石街(Boulder Ct)的三谷大學和其他三處蘇曉萍所擁有的房屋執行搜索令。移民局是從2010年5月開始調查此案,該校是在2009年2月獲准核發簽證。2009年5月,該校只有11名學生持有F-1簽證,至2010年5月增至939人。
根據訴訟書指出,取得簽證學生中,超過95%來自印度。三谷大學的資料顯示,超過半數學生住在桑尼維爾同一棟公寓,而該公寓經理向移民局官員表示,從2007年6月到2009年8月間,只有四名大學生住進該公寓,之後再也沒有大學生入住。因此調查員認為,三谷大學謊報簽證學生的住址資料,實際上這些學生不住在加州。
該校一名不願具名的教授表示,他對此案感到震驚,由於三谷大學也提供網路課程,他自2009年起便在自宅透過網路授課,根據他親身經驗,他一直認為三谷是所正當大學。他說:「我教授的都是優質課程,我的學生也都非常優秀。」他並表示,寒假結束後,學校原本應在1月10日開學,但因故延後,周四剛收到蘇曉萍電郵告知,很快便會開學。
根據三谷大學網站的資料,創辦人兼校長蘇曉萍來自中國,1991年畢業於清華大學機械工程系,1997年從戴維斯加大取得碩士學位,2001年從柏克萊加大取得博士學位。

涉嫌發出多達千餘假學生簽證的舊金山東灣布利桑頓市(Pleasanton)的三谷大學(Tri-Valley University),已遭聯邦政府關閉。該校可能有千餘學生失去學生身分,而面臨遭遣返命摺_@項可能是美國歷來最大的大學簽證弊案,涉案人為三谷大學的華裔創辦人兼校長蘇曉萍(Susan Xiao Ping Su,音譯)。她涉嫌掩護非法移民集團,核發假學生簽證及洗錢。
三谷大學有1555學生,其中95%是印度國民。
該校2009年2月獲准核發I-20入學許可及學生簽證。該校2009年5月只有11名學生持有F-1簽證,至2010年5月增至939人。
聯邦移民暨海關執法局察覺有異後,由探員假扮成外籍學生前往。探員表示在美國身分有問題,希望取得學生簽證,但並無意在三谷大學修課,而蘇曉萍仍舊同意發出F-1學生簽證。
起訴書指出,三谷大學透過非法核發學生簽證,讓外籍人士取得學生簽證留在美國,並因此賺進數百萬元。而那些學生涉及使用假住址,並在美非法工作。
美参议员联名敦促整顿“野鸡”大学
2011-03-08 20:09:31
美国五位参议员联名致函移民海关署,要求严肃处理向外国学生兜售签证的“野鸡大学”。上月加州一所由华人创办的三谷大学(Tri-Valley University)就因此问题被移民局查封。议员承诺将出台新议案,加大对此类机构的惩罚力度。
上月被查处的三谷大学是五位议员联名致函的动因之一。从学校网站得知,其创始人是一名叫苏晓萍(音译,Susan Xiao-Ping Su)的华人。她在简历中介绍,自己于1991年从清华大学电子机械学院毕业,2001年从加州伯克利大学获得博士学位。三谷大学于2008年开始“招生”,每学期学费为2700美元。
移民海关局在一月底的检查中发现,其普莱森顿(Pleasanton)的校舍空无一人。学校1,500名学生绝大多数来自印度,来美国之后居住在各个不同州,很多人从未到过三谷大学。美国法律规定,学生若想维持合法身份,必须出席课堂并按时完成学业。一些印度学生之后受到移民局审问,并可能被遣送回国。移民局同时没收了苏晓萍称用“学费”购置的办公楼,一套公寓,和一处豪宅,但尚未提出指控。
五位参议员范士丹(Dianne Feinstein,D-Calif)、舒默(Chuck Schumer,D-N.Y)、麦克卡斯基尔(Claire McCaskill,D-Mo)、泰斯特(Jon Tester,D-Mont)、纳尔逊(Bill Nelson,D-Fl)在联名信中指出,冒牌大学操纵学生签证,谋取暴利的行为对整个项目构成威胁,对其他签证申请者也不公平。他们还提到,数位实施9-11袭击的恐怖分子便持学生签证。
议员敦促移民海关局在90天内做出回应,出台针对冒牌学校的评估项目,并实地走访每所可能存在造假行为的学校,并强调一些提供所谓“远程教育”的学校应引起特别注意。
他们还指出国务院和移民海关署之间应加强信息共享,避免为同一间学校授予不同数目的签证。最近被关闭的加州三谷大学只被允许招收30名国际学生,却从国务院获得1,500份签证。
面对该现象,议员承诺将出台新议案,提高对冒牌大学的惩罚力度。他们认为目前的惩罚措施过轻,而向外国学生出售签证已成为暴利行业,因此才不断有人知法犯法。
